What is PCM?
The Powertrain Control Module (Acura Vigor PCM) serves as the central control unit for the powertrain system, which includes the engine, transmission, and other related components. It integrates the functions of both the ECU and TCM (Transmission Control Module) into a single unit, streamlining communication and enhancing overall efficiency. The PCM plays a vital role in coordinating the operation of various systems within the powertrain to optimize performance and fuel economy.

Overview of Control Modules:
A control module is a device that receives input signals, processes them, and generates output commands based on predefined logic or algorithms. It acts as a central hub that coordinates the operation of various components within a system. Control modules can be found in a wide range of applications, including automotive, industrial automation, aerospace, and more.

PID Control: PID (Proportional-Integral-Derivative) control modules combine proportional, integral, and derivative control to achieve accurate and stable control of a system. They are widely used in industrial automation and robotics.

The PCM is essentially the bridge between the electronic components of the vehicle and the mechanical systems. It controls the fuel injection, ignition timing, transmission shifting, and emission control systems to ensure that the vehicle operates smoothly and efficiently.

A control module, also known as a control unit, is a small but critical component in a system that oversees and regulates the operations of the device it is installed in. It acts as a central processing unit that receives input signals from various sensors and executes the necessary output commands to maintain the desired function or performance. Control modules can be found in a wide range of applications, from household appliances to complex industrial machinery.
